Description

Survodutide is a synthetic peptide currently under investigation for its potential therapeutic applications, particularly in the treatment of metabolic disorders such as obesity, type 2 diabetes, and Metabolic Associated Steatohepatitis (MASH). Structurally, survodutide is a conjugate of a modified glucagon-like peptide-1 (GLP-1) receptor agonist and a glucagon receptor agonist.

 

Mechanism of Action

 

Survodutide functions through dual receptor activation:

  • GLP-1 Receptor Agonism:

    • Enhancement of Insulin Secretion: The activation of GLP-1 receptors on pancreatic beta cells potentiates glucose-dependent insulin secretion. This mechanism aids in the reduction of postprandial blood glucose levels.
    • Inhibition of Glucagon Secretion: By acting on GLP-1 receptors, survodutide decreases the secretion of glucagon, a hormone that raises blood glucose levels by stimulating hepatic glucose production.
    • Appetite Suppression: GLP-1 receptor agonists are known to act on the hypothalamus, leading to reduced appetite and caloric intake, contributing to weight loss.
  • Glucagon Receptor Agonism:

    • Increased Energy Expenditure: Activation of glucagon receptors enhances lipolysis and energy expenditure. This process is facilitated by the increase in cyclic AMP (cAMP) levels, which activates protein kinase A (PKA) and other downstream signaling pathways that promote the utilization of stored fat for energy.
    • Improvement in Hepatic Function: Glucagon receptor activation has been shown to reduce hepatic steatosis and fibrosis, which is particularly beneficial in conditions like MASH. It promotes the mobilization and oxidation of fatty acids in the liver.

 

Key Functions and Benefits of Survodutide

 

  • Enhances Insulin Secretion:

    • Stimulates the pancreas to release more insulin in response to glucose, aiding in better blood sugar control.
    • Improves beta-cell function and survival.
  • Suppresses Appetite:

    • Acts on the central nervous system to reduce hunger and food intake, contributing to weight loss.
    • Enhances satiety and delays gastric emptying.
  • Increases Energy Expenditure:

    • Boosts metabolic rate and thermogenesis, helping to burn more calories.
    • Promotes fat oxidation and reduces adiposity.
  • Improves Liver Function:

    • Reduces liver fat accumulation, inflammation, and fibrosis, which is beneficial for conditions like MASH.
    • Enhances hepatic insulin sensitivity and reduces hepatic glucose production.
  • Prolonged Activity:

    • Demonstrates a pharmacokinetic profile with extended half-life, allowing for less frequent dosing schedules.
    • Improves patient adherence and convenience.

 

Preclinical and Clinical Studies

 

In preclinical studies, survodutide has demonstrated significant efficacy in reducing body weight, improving metabolic parameters, and ameliorating liver inflammation and fibrosis in various animal models. The peptide has shown promising results in reducing hepatic steatosis and improving liver histology, which are critical endpoints in the management of MASH.

 

Ongoing Research

 

Clinical trials are ongoing to evaluate the safety, efficacy, and optimal dosing regimen of survodutide in humans. These studies aim to confirm the preclinical findings and determine the therapeutic potential of survodutide in treating obesity, type 2 diabetes, and MASH. The trials also focus on understanding the long-term effects, tolerability, and impact on liver health.

 

Conclusion

 

Overall, survodutide represents a promising candidate in the expanding field of peptide-based therapies for metabolic diseases. Its dual receptor activation mechanism offers a multifaceted approach to weight management, glucose regulation, and liver health, making it a potential breakthrough in the treatment of obesity, type 2 diabetes, and MASH.
